首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

JSONata:提取包含时间戳的最低/最高温度

JSONata是一种用于数据转换和查询的查询语言。它可以用于从JSON数据中提取和转换特定的字段或数据。

在这个问答内容中,我们可以使用JSONata来提取包含时间戳的最低/最高温度。具体步骤如下:

  1. 首先,我们需要了解JSON数据的结构。假设我们有一个名为"weatherData"的JSON对象,其中包含了一组天气数据,每个数据包含时间戳和温度字段。
  2. 使用JSONata查询语言,我们可以编写一个查询表达式来提取包含时间戳的最低/最高温度。以下是一个示例查询表达式:
  3. $min(temperature.timestamp), $max(temperature.timestamp)
  4. 在这个表达式中,我们使用了$min$max函数来计算最低和最高时间戳。
  5. 将查询表达式应用于JSON数据。可以使用JSONata的解析器或相关的编程语言库来执行查询。以下是一个示例使用JavaScript执行查询的代码:
  6. 将查询表达式应用于JSON数据。可以使用JSONata的解析器或相关的编程语言库来执行查询。以下是一个示例使用JavaScript执行查询的代码:
  7. 运行以上代码将输出最低和最高时间戳。
  8. 应用场景:JSONata可以在各种数据处理和转换任务中使用,特别适用于从复杂的JSON数据结构中提取特定字段或进行聚合计算。在天气数据分析、物联网数据处理、移动应用程序开发等领域都可以使用JSONata来处理和查询数据。
  9. 推荐的腾讯云相关产品:腾讯云提供了多个与数据处理和存储相关的产品,可以与JSONata结合使用。例如,腾讯云的云数据库CDB可以用于存储和查询JSON数据,腾讯云的云函数SCF可以用于执行JSONata查询等。具体产品介绍和链接地址可以参考腾讯云官方文档。

总结:JSONata是一种用于数据转换和查询的查询语言,可以用于从JSON数据中提取和转换特定的字段或数据。它在各种数据处理和转换任务中都有广泛的应用,包括天气数据分析、物联网数据处理、移动应用程序开发等。腾讯云提供了多个与数据处理和存储相关的产品,可以与JSONata结合使用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券